A connection between the VPN server and the VPN client 98.125.95.# has been established, but the VPN connection cannot be completed. The most common cause for this is that a firewall or router between the VPN server and the VPN client is not configured to allow Generic Routing Encapsulation (GRE) packets (protocol 47).

For example, if you're unable to connect your Android phone, try the same on your PC. If both are unable to connect, the problem is with your network. Try a different network then. Otherwise, if your PC is able to connect, there's something wrong with the configuration on your phone and VPN won't connect.
